在使用python連線hbase安裝各種依賴包的過程中需要根據 hbase 的原始碼來生成乙個gen-py包,我使用的是python3.5,hbase的版本是1.2.6,在/hbase-1.2.6.1/hbase-thrift/src/main/resources/org/apache/hadoop/hbase 資料夾下面有兩個資料夾 thrift thrift2,網上查來的許多資料都是使用 thrift下的 hbase,執行thrift -gen py hbase.thrift :但是在我這裡總是報乙個錯:
後來我選擇使用 thrift 下的 hbase.thrift:果然成功了
使用Python連線Hbase資料庫
在使用python連線hbase資料庫時,會出現如下錯誤提示,主要原因是版本帶來的語法相容性問題,因此需要用hbase.py和ttypes.py將路徑d program files programdata anaconda3 lib site packages hbase 自己的python安裝目錄...
使用phoenix連線hbase
hbase本身不支援sql查詢,為了實現這個功能,引入了phoenix,通過它可以實現hbase的sql查詢。這裡記錄下如何配置並使用phoenix來操作hbase。1 解壓檔案tar zxvf apache phoenix 4.14.0 hbase 1.1 bin.tar.gz 2 拷貝phoen...
python 連線伺服器 Python伺服器連線
我想你用python編寫乙個客戶端,把資料報傳送到tcp伺服器。我不知道伺服器實現,但它總是返回這樣乙個men 例如在nc server 4444之後 make your choice 1 test1 2 test2 3 insert two numbers 4 test4 5 test5 6 te...